— RAW will expand to a three-hour show, starting with the 1,000th episode on July 23 at 8/7 CT on USA Network. No one has had a positive feeling on the addition of one hour to RAW. Rather, those talked to are “genuinely concerned” about the harm making it a three-hour show on a weekly basis could do to the WWE product.
— The synopsis for next week’s RAW reads: “John Laurinaitis runs television’s longest-running weekly episodic show.”
— It’s week four of WWE.com’s celebration of the 1,000th episode of RAW. This week, look back at shows from March 1, 1999 to January 22, 2001 in a photo gallery.
